As the owner of the Junior Welterweight title, Mayweather has most pundits calling him, pound for pound, 2005s greatest boxer. Born on February 24, 1977, in Grand Rapids, Michigan, Floyd Jr. has boxing in his blood. His father, Floyd Sr., fought Sugar Ray Leonard in the late 70s, whilst his uncle Roger was a Junior Lightweight and Super Lightweight champion. It was no surprise then, that Floyd Jr. showed an aptitude for boxing from a very young age. When he had received adequate instruction from his dad and uncle, Floyd entered the globe of amateur boxing as an adolescent. Fighting at 126 pounds, Mayweather put with each other an amazing 84-6 record as an amateur, winning Golden Gloves championships in 1993, 1994, and 1996. Mayweather made the Olympic group in 1996 and at the Atlanta Olympics, he beat boxers from Kazakhstan, Armenia and Cuba ahead of falling to a Bulgarian in a hugely controversial semi-final bout. Mayweather had to settle for the bronze medal. Lidocaine is a regional anesthetic numbing medication. It produces discomfort relief by blocking the signals at the nerve endings in the skin. Lidocaine topical systems are employed for discomfort relief and for managing discomfort connected with herpes zoster virus infection of the skin shingles.
